What is Randall Emmett's net worth and salary?

Randall Emmett is an American film and television producer and director who has a net worth of $500 thousand. Randall Emmett is best known as the co-founder and chairman of Emmett/Furla/Oasis Films, a prolific indie banner that specializes in low- to mid-budget action and crime thrillers anchored by marquee names. Over a career spanning more than a hundred producing credits, he has leveraged foreign presales, tax-incentive shoots, and tight schedules to assemble commercially reliable packages featuring stars such asBruce Willis,Robert De Niro,Sylvester Stallone,Nicolas Cage,John Travolta,Al Pacino, andMel Gibson, with cumulative global grosses cited in excess of $1.2 billion. His slate includes studio-released titles like "End of Watch," "2 Guns," "Escape Plan," and "Lone Survivor," prestige efforts tied toMartin Scorsese, including "Silence" and a producer credit on "The Irishman," and his directing debut, "Midnight in the Switchgrass." On television, he produced the hit Starz series "Power," which ran six seasons and spawned multiple spin-offs. Emmett's profile expanded beyond Hollywood circles through appearances on "Vanderpump Rules" alongside then-fiancéeLala Kent.

Randall Emmett was born in March 1971 in Miami, Florida. His parents worked in the insurance business, and he developed an early fascination with movies and television. As a teenager, he attended Miami's prestigious New World School of the Arts, where he studied acting before earning a scholarship to the School of Visual Arts in Manhattan. There, he shifted his focus from acting to producing, later recalling that while "everyone else wanted to be a writer or director," he was the only student who wanted to be a producer.

By 2022, amid accusations of financial mismanagement and fraud, Emmett acknowledged that EFO was "essentially defunct" and said he had resigned from the company to launch a new venture, Convergence Entertainment. He has since continued working sporadically as an independent producer.

In mid-2021, Randall Emmett filed court documents requesting that a Los Angeles judge reduce his monthly child support obligations to his ex-wife, actressAmbyr Childers. He sought relief from a January 2021 order requiring him to maintain a $50,000 fund for their children's non-tuition expenses, citing significant financial strain. In the filing, Emmett claimed to be carrying roughly $500,000 in IRS debt, paying $15,000 per month to the agency and an additional $10,000 per month to American Express as part of a structured repayment plan.
